Q: How are Deep Multi Well Plates primarily used in laboratories?
A: Deep Multi Well Plates are used for sample storage, assay processing, high-throughput screening, and compound management in various laboratory environments, including biotechnology, pharmaceutical, and chemical analysis.
Q: What surface coating and well bottom shapes are available for these plates?
A: These plates come with a choice of round, U, or V-bottom wells, and are available with or without surface treatments-such as non-treated, low-binding, or cell-culture treated-to suit specific experimental requirements.
Q: Where can Deep Multi Well Plates be stored in terms of temperature and humidity?
A: They are stable for storage between -80C and +121C, and their polypropylene material ensures that ambient humidity does not affect their performance or sample integrity.
Q: When is it advantageous to choose pre-sterilized plates over non-sterile ones?
A: Pre-sterilized plates are recommended when working in sensitive environments where sterility is crucial, such as in clinical diagnostics or cell culture experiments. Non-sterile options are suitable for less stringent applications.
Q: What benefits do the alpha-numeric grid markings provide?
A: Alpha-numeric grid markings enhance sample management by ensuring clear, easy identification of each well, thereby minimizing potential handling errors and improving workflow efficiency.
